LAND O' LAKES, FL — The Florida Lottery announced Monday that William Mallette, 61, of Land O' Lakes, claimed a $1 million top prize from The Fastest Road To $1,000,000 scratch-off game using a secured drop box at Florida Lottery Headquarters in Tallahassee.

He chose to receive his winnings as a one-time, lump-sum payment of $790,000.00.

Mallette purchased his winning ticket from Shortcut Marathon, 5736 Land O' Lakes Blvd., Land O' Lakes. The retailer will receive a $2,000 bonus commission for selling the winning scratch-Off ticket.

The $30 game, The Fastest Road To $1,000,000, launched in February and features 155 top prizes of $1 million and more than $948 million in cash prizes. The game's overall odds of winning are 1-in-2.79.
